Prayer for Married Couples

Heavenly Father, you have joined my wife/husband and I together in holy matrimony.  You have served as our mentor, friend, companion and confidant.  In our journey together as a married couple, we continuously face many situations which challenge our relationship. Obstacles, misunderstandings, petty fights, and much more serious arguments have all been part of our marriage.  We seek your guidance dear Lord so we do not forget our sworn vows to each other.  I understand that every obstacle we face is part of something bigger.  I believe that you have a plan for our marriage.  Marriage is a sacred sacrament where two people promise to love each other through good and bad times.  Help me dear Lord not to forget that my wife/husband will make mistakes.  I sometimes fail to recognize that I’m the cause of our arguments.  I have to realize that our marriage will not be perfect.  I want to keep my partner happy and content.  I want to be able to fulfill my duties as a wife/husband.  Lord, I know you are listening to my prayer.  I know that you understand the deepest worries of my heart.  Everyday I do my best to keep in mind that everything I’m doing is for your greater glory.  My partner and I love each other very much, but temptation is everywhere. I humbly ask for your mercy and compassion dear Lord that we may never give in to worldly temptations.  Give us the strength and courage we need to get through our problems.  Bless our marriage so we may continue to serve you as devout Christians.  Make us your instruments to proclaim the faith and worship you.  Let us be an inspiration to others, so that they may understand the beauty of marriage.  As we grow together in love, guide us to the right path so that we may never lose sight of what’s important.  I would like to thank you dear Lord for letting me find a partner who I will spend the rest of my life with.  I feel so blessed that I have someone to be with me through thick and thin.  Thank you dear Lord for listening to my prayer and understanding my situation.  You are the only true God, and I trust in you.

Amen.

Short Marriage Prayer

God, I want to thank you for having this wonderful person cross my path that I will be sharing the rest of my life with.  Through him you have shown me how much you love me.  I will continue to do Jesus’s work as I have done before.  I know we will have both good and bad times, but no matter how difficult things get, I know that we can always confide in you.

Amen.

Prayer for Getting Married

Dearest Lord, I will soon be married to my wife/husband.  It’s going to be a day of celebration and rejoicing.  We are two people who crossed paths and fell in love.  This would not be possible without your never-ending support and guidance.  In the early stages of our relationship, we weren’t sure if we were meant for each other.  We used to be young and confused.  Now that we’ve been a couple for a few years now, we’re finally ready to become one.  I understand how sacred this sacrament is which is why I want to be fully prepared physically, mentally, and emotionally.  My wife/husband is a good person, and I’m very blessed to spend the rest of my life with him/her.  Getting to know my future wife/husband was an amazing journey.  I have seen both their positive and negative traits.  I know that married life will be so much different from where we are now.  I look forward to being a wife/husband, because I know that it will open up opportunities for me to improve myself.  Whatever challenges we may face in our marriage, I know you will continue to be there and serve as our guide.  Marriage is a big step in our relationship but as we have carefully planned it, we can confidently say that we’re ready to commit.  In the near future, my partner and I will soon have children of our own.  It’s our responsibility to make sure that we are the best role model for our kids.  Help me dear Lord to fulfill my duties as a wife/husband.  Be my constant reminder that I am a child of God.  My actions, words, and decisions should all be done for your greater glory.  As a devout Christian, I will make sure to follow your teachings regarding marriage.  I am forever grateful that you have given me this wonderful privilege to marry the love of my life.  Thank you for this great blessing.

Amen.
